DynamoDB Developer Resume Tips

Lead with access patterns

Open with partition-key and query-pattern design.

Show index strategy

Explain GSI/LSI choices tied to reads you supported.

Place Streams and DAX carefully

Mention Streams or DAX only when used.

Connect Terraform honestly

Describe IaC only for DynamoDB resources you managed.

No invented RU savings

Discuss on-demand capacity without fabricated cost percentages.

Interview-test every line

Keep only statements you can expand into a concrete DynamoDB Developer story without guessing.
